On 20/09/2012 19:00, Chris Webb wrote:
My advice would be don't do it through iTunes unless you've already
upgraded to Mac OS X Lion 10.7.5 or Mountain Lion 10.8.2 _AND_ iTunes
10.7.
The best way to do it on an iOS device is to go to *Settings - General
- Software Update *and let it do it whilst connected to your wireless
network. i've successfully updated an iPad 2, a new iPad, an iPhone
3Gs and an iPhone 4.
You'll still have to update to 10.7.5 or 10.8.2 and iTunes 10.7.
